Skip to content

Commit ee49fa0

Browse files
committed
[ModelExecutionData] include the original exception if reraised as ModelExecutionException
1 parent 31f113e commit ee49fa0

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

OMPython/OMCSession.py

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-535,9 +535,9 @@ def run(self) -> int:
535535
if stderr:
536536
raise ModelExecutionException(f"Error running model executable {repr(cmdl)}: {stderr}")
537537
except subprocess.TimeoutExpired as ex:
538-
raise ModelExecutionException(f"Timeout running model executable {repr(cmdl)}") from ex
538+
raise ModelExecutionException(f"Timeout running model executable {repr(cmdl)}: {ex}") from ex
539539
except subprocess.CalledProcessError as ex:
540-
raise ModelExecutionException(f"Error running model executable {repr(cmdl)}") from ex
540+
raise ModelExecutionException(f"Error running model executable {repr(cmdl)}: {ex}") from ex
541541

542542
return returncode
543543

0 commit comments

Comments
 (0)